Chevron is accepting online applications for the position Machinery Engineer through June 2nd, 2024 at 11:59 p.m. (PDT).
The Machinery Engineer position is part of the Richmond Refinery’s Reliability &; Integrity organization and reports to the Reliability and Machinery Engineering Team Lead. The team consists of 10-12 reliability and machinery engineers and is a key contributor in achieving the refinery’s goals of safe and reliable operation.

Responsibilities for this position may include but are not limited to:

  • Work to detect and prevent machinery failure through the use of predictive and preventative techniques.
  • Develop bad actor resolutions, repair and maintenance strategies, and design alternatives that address health, safety, environmental, reliability, operability, and maintainability issues.
  • Improve technical tools and work processes.
  • Ensure rotating equipment records are documented accurately and completely with emphasis on root cause identification, scope of repairs, and detailed records of internal or external inspections.Ensure engineering design adheres to Refinery, industry, regulation, and Corporate specifications.
  • Consider Total Cost of Ownership when selecting new equipment, components, or support systems.
  • Provide support to Maintenance, Technical and Operations personnel on critical field jobs, and manage these jobs or their critical parts as needed.Provide support to Maintenance, Technical and Operations personnel on development and review of machinery repair checklists, preventive or predictive maintenance checklists, and maintenance or operating procedures as necessary.
  • Effectively use the Incident & Investigation Reporting system to identify behavior and work process improvement opportunities, root causes, and effective corrective actions that will help eliminate incidents and injuries.
  • Support the Rotating Equipment Re-work, Spare Run, and Kit-box Restocking processes.
  • Lead machinery root cause failure analysis efforts using support tools such as 5-Why and Taproot.
  • Use in advanced machinery monitoring techniques and systems to support condition based and predictive monitoring of rotating machinery (System1, Adre, compressor performance modeling etc.)
  • Actively participate in the planning and execution of TAs, both planned and unplanned.

Required Qualifications:

  • Bachelor of Science in Engineering or Data Science
  • 5+ years of experience in a complex process facility such as a refinery

Preferred Qualifications:

  • Vibration Institute CATII or equivalent
  • 10+ years of experience in a complex process facility such as a refinery
